r"""
|
||||
.. dialect:: mysql+aiomysql
|
||||
:name: aiomysql
|
||||
:dbapi: aiomysql
|
||||
:connectstring: mysql+aiomysql://user:password@host:port/dbname[?key=value&key=value...]
|
||||
:url: https://github.com/aio-libs/aiomysql
|
||||
|
||||
The aiomysql dialect is SQLAlchemy's second Python asyncio dialect.
|
||||
|
||||
Using a special asyncio mediation layer, the aiomysql dialect is usable
|
||||
as the backend for the :ref:`SQLAlchemy asyncio <asyncio_toplevel>`
|
||||
extension package.
|
||||
|
||||
This dialect should normally be used only with the
|
||||
:func:`_asyncio.create_async_engine` engine creation function::
|
||||
|
||||
from sqlalchemy.ext.asyncio import create_async_engine
|
||||
|
||||
engine = create_async_engine(
|
||||
"mysql+aiomysql://user:pass@hostname/dbname?charset=utf8mb4"
|
||||
)
|
||||
|
||||
""" # noqa
